Part 2. The Central Limit Theorem 1. Recently, your college surveyed 100 students across campus and found that the mean age of students taking calculus is 23. (Suppose the standard deviation is 2.01 years.) (a) Explain why we can assume that the distribution is approximately normal. (b) What are the mean and standard deviation for the sample mean ages of calculus students? (c) Find the 90th percentile for the mean age of calculus students. Round to 1 decimal place.
